4

The wiki seems to imply Turing-completeness because no restrictions on jumps are specified here https://ripple.com/wiki/Contracts#Foundational_Ops.

Which is it and what (if any) is the actual intention ?

Cheers ...

Alex Kravets
  • 518
  • 2
  • 9

1 Answers1

5

It should be Turing complete. However, every time a contract is invoked, the maximum number of operations the contract can perform is limited. Operations that access a contract must specify an operation count limit to get a limit higher than the default. Higher limits require higher transaction fees.

David Schwartz
  • 51,308
  • 6
  • 106
  • 177